“German Milwaukee: Its History, Its Recipes”

The title of this weighty, heavily illustrated hardback book says it all.  Written by Trudy Knauss Paradis with E.J. Brumder, with photographs by Katherine Bish, the book is a mix of history and recipes of German specialties.  With tons of illustrations that capture long-lost Milwaukee, the volume focuses on the contributions made by German immigrants and their descendants, from the beer industry to architecture to shopkeepers to heavy industry and more.  E.J. will remind us of Milwaukee’s German flavor and influence.  The recipes in the book come in two forms.  Photos from the well-known Brew City schnitzel barons like Mader’s , Karl Ratzsch’s, Bavarian Inn and Weissgerber’s Gasthaus, but even more interesting are the ordinary German-American Milwaukeeans who share treasured recipes and family lore.  Bring a guest, sit back, and enjoy taking a walk back through the streets of

German Milwaukee!
